You will require to full Kind C-3, called an Employee Claim Form, and mail it to the nearest Employees' Payment Insurance Claim Workplace. Right here are the remainder of the steps you need to adhere to when submitting your case: Ask your doctor to total Kind C-4 entitled Physician's Initial Report and mail it to the same district office.
If the insurance firm has actually not accepted or rejected the insurance claim with seven days, it will certainly begin to pay you benefits within 18 days. Your doctor must submit a development report to the workers' settlement board every 45 days. The insurance provider agent will certainly think about whether you are still in the active procedure of recovery if you have not gone back to work within 12 weeks.

While coping with the effects of an occupational injury can really feel separating, rest ensured that you are not alone. According to information from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Data (BLS), close to three percent of full time workers get injured on the task each year.
Centers for Illness Control and Prevention (CDC) inform a similar story. According to the CDC, office injuries are incredibly common. Virtually one in four non-fatal job injuries arising from days missed out on from work is the outcome of a slip, journey, or fall, and even more than a quarter of a million workers are required to take some time off due to accidents, impacts, and various other crashes involving tools and various other things.
The United State Occupational Safety and Health And Wellness Administration (OSHA) preserves a checklist of the 10 most-commonly-cited safety and security offenses on task sites in the United States. Regular with the CDC's stats, four of the "leading 10" include safety and security concerns linked to drops, and 3 connect to accidents including forklifts, machinery, and other tools.
